数据库优化技术是干什么的工作

2024-03-28 16:47

数据库优化技术:提高性能、减少资源消耗的关键

在现代信息化的社会,数据库已经成为企业、组织、政府等各个领域不可或缺的信息存储和管理工具。随着数据量的不断增长,数据库的性能和资源消耗问题逐渐凸显。为了解决这些问题,数据库优化技术应运而生。本文将介绍数据库优化技术的工作原理、重要性以及具体的应用方法。

一、数据库优化技术概述

数据库优化技术主要是通过优化数据库结构、索引设计、查询语句等方式,提高数据库的性能和减少资源消耗。它涉及到数据库的多个方面,包括硬件、软件、网络等。通过优化技术,可以使得数据库更加高效地运行,减少等待时间和资源消耗,提高系统的整体性能。

二、数据库优化技术的重要性

1. 提高系统性能:通过优化技术,可以减少查询时间、提高数据访问速度,从而提高系统的整体性能。

2. 减少资源消耗:优化技术可以减少数据库的磁盘空间占用、CPU和内存的消耗,从而降低系统的运营成本。

3. 增强数据安全性:通过优化技术,可以更好地保护数据的安全性和完整性,防止数据泄露和破坏。

三、数据库优化技术的应用方法

1. 优化数据库结构:合理地设计数据库表结构、字段类型、索引等,可以提高数据存储和访问的效率。例如,减少字段数量、合理设置索引类型等。

2. 优化查询语句:通过优化查询语句,可以减少查询时间、提高查询效率。例如,使用合适的查询条件、避免全表扫描等。

3. 调整数据库参数:根据实际情况调整数据库参数,可以提高数据库的性能和稳定性。例如,调整缓冲区大小、连接池大小等。

4. 实施备份与恢复策略:定期备份数据并实施恢复策略,可以防止数据丢失并确保系统的可用性。

5. 监控和维护:定期监控数据库的性能和资源消耗情况,及时发现并解决问题,确保系统的稳定运行。

四、结论

随着信息技术的不断发展和数据量的不断增加,数据库优化技术越来越受到重视。通过掌握并应用这些技术,可以确保数据库系统的性能和稳定性,满足企业、组织等各个领域的需求。因此,我们需要不断学习和研究数据库优化技术,为企业和社会的发展提供有力的支持。